Output 9ef33a760008d7c736977c6ec46c62fcc13bcbf35cbe2227fb09121b0471525f:0

value
22930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85464060dc227c116d2b8b924afb866ec4c0177a OP_EQUAL
address
3DqhxDT4hQXn98jghaA7ehckbA1H8L8k86
transaction
9ef33a760008d7c736977c6ec46c62fcc13bcbf35cbe2227fb09121b0471525f
spent
true